DC Defenders official Week 1 depth chart

XFL’s DC Defenders have released their Week 1 depth chart for all your DFS needs.

For those of us preparing for XFL DFS, there is some good news. We have official depth charts! With such new teams these depth charts will likely change quickly, but this should be how they start out Week 1, which will help us a lot when trying to set our lineups.

Cardale Jones leads the team at quarterback and has the arm and legs to help them move the ball. He also has a good group of receivers to throw to and a QB whisperer in Pep Hamilton to guide him.

Jhurrel Pressley will be the lead back. He led the AAF in rushing yards at a decent 4.5 yards per carry. The team does have four total running backs, so we could see Donnel Pumphrey and others cut into Pressley’s work, but he should see the majority of the carries.

Rashad Ross broke out last year in the AAF, but is listed as DeAndre Thompkins’ backup. Ross was traded for Tre McBride on January 12th, which seemed like an odd trade, but we have no real information on why it happened or why Ross is behind Thompkins. The good news for Ross in Week 1 is that Thompkins is out with an injury, so he should be able to get work no matter.

With Thompkins out, Malachi Dupre is the only healthy starting receiver. For some reason they have only listed two starting receivers though, and we know Hamilton will have more than that usually.
